Whilst some conifers, such as yew, can withstand hard pruning, you must take care not to prune into old wood for most varieties as the tree will not regrow. Instead, you should be looking only to trim the green foliage to a mossy finish, taking care not to prune into the brown wood. WebHeading back pruning. Heading back pruning is the process of cutting a branch’s “head,” or terminal growth, back to a bud, a stub, or a smaller branch. These cuts enhance the tree’s shape and often produce new growth below the cut. Plant larger conifers such as fir, spruce, and pine only in areas where heavy pruning will not be necessary, since new shoots will not develop from cuts made in the older wood. Conifers do not need pruning for spacing of lateral branches. Branches emerge close to each other but will not crowd out each other or the leader. plant cycle for toddlersWebFeb 18, 2024 · Pruning conifers regularly is essential to maintain compact growth.
